Address

MPDPZFqoNPAvE1Nnn6UmiumEURZkpWtWbuCopy

Total Received

202.67104364 QTUM

Total Sent

202.67104364 QTUM

№ Transactions

4

Final Balance

0 QTUM

Transactions
Filter